34/* ATA/ATAPI device parameters */
35struct ata_params {
36/*000*/ u_int16_t       config;         /* configuration info */
37#define ATA_PROTO_MASK                  0x8003
38#define ATA_PROTO_ATAPI                 0x8000
39#define ATA_PROTO_ATAPI_12              0x8000
40#define ATA_PROTO_ATAPI_16              0x8001
41#define ATA_ATAPI_TYPE_MASK             0x1f00
42#define ATA_ATAPI_TYPE_DIRECT           0x0000  /* disk/floppy */
43#define ATA_ATAPI_TYPE_TAPE             0x0100  /* streaming tape */
44#define ATA_ATAPI_TYPE_CDROM            0x0500  /* CD-ROM device */
45#define ATA_ATAPI_TYPE_OPTICAL          0x0700  /* optical disk */
46#define ATA_DRQ_MASK                    0x0060
47#define ATA_DRQ_SLOW                    0x0000  /* cpu 3 ms delay */
48#define ATA_DRQ_INTR                    0x0020  /* interrupt 10 ms delay */
49#define ATA_DRQ_FAST                    0x0040  /* accel 50 us delay */
50
51/*001*/ u_int16_t       cylinders;              /* # of cylinders */
52	u_int16_t       reserved2;
53/*003*/ u_int16_t       heads;                  /* # heads */
54	u_int16_t       obsolete4;
55	u_int16_t       obsolete5;
56/*006*/ u_int16_t       sectors;                /* # sectors/track */
57/*007*/ u_int16_t       vendor7[3];
58/*010*/ u_int8_t        serial[20];             /* serial number */
59/*020*/ u_int16_t       retired20;
60	u_int16_t       retired21;
61	u_int16_t       obsolete22;
62/*023*/ u_int8_t        revision[8];            /* firmware revision */
63/*027*/ u_int8_t        model[40];              /* model name */
64/*047*/ u_int16_t       sectors_intr;           /* sectors per interrupt */
65/*048*/ u_int16_t       usedmovsd;              /* double word read/write? */
66/*049*/ u_int16_t       capabilities1;
67#define ATA_SUPPORT_DMA                 0x0100
68#define ATA_SUPPORT_LBA                 0x0200
69#define ATA_SUPPORT_OVERLAP             0x4000
70
71/*050*/ u_int16_t       capabilities2;
72/*051*/ u_int16_t       retired_piomode;        /* PIO modes 0-2 */
73#define ATA_RETIRED_PIO_MASK            0x0300
74
75/*052*/ u_int16_t       retired_dmamode;        /* DMA modes */
76#define ATA_RETIRED_DMA_MASK            0x0003
77
78/*053*/ u_int16_t       atavalid;               /* fields valid */
79#define ATA_FLAG_54_58                  0x0001  /* words 54-58 valid */
80#define ATA_FLAG_64_70                  0x0002  /* words 64-70 valid */
81#define ATA_FLAG_88                     0x0004  /* word 88 valid */
82
83/*054*/ u_int16_t       current_cylinders;
84/*055*/ u_int16_t       current_heads;
85/*056*/ u_int16_t       current_sectors;
86/*057*/ u_int16_t       current_size_1;
87/*058*/ u_int16_t       current_size_2;
88/*059*/ u_int16_t       multi;
89#define ATA_MULTI_VALID                 0x0100
90
91/*060*/ u_int16_t       lba_size_1;
92	u_int16_t       lba_size_2;
93	u_int16_t       obsolete62;
94/*063*/ u_int16_t       mwdmamodes;             /* multiword DMA modes */
95/*064*/ u_int16_t       apiomodes;              /* advanced PIO modes */
96
97/*065*/ u_int16_t       mwdmamin;               /* min. M/W DMA time/word ns */
98/*066*/ u_int16_t       mwdmarec;               /* rec. M/W DMA time ns */
99/*067*/ u_int16_t       pioblind;               /* min. PIO cycle w/o flow */
100/*068*/ u_int16_t       pioiordy;               /* min. PIO cycle IORDY flow */
101	u_int16_t       reserved69;
102	u_int16_t       reserved70;
103/*071*/ u_int16_t       rlsovlap;               /* rel time (us) for overlap */
104/*072*/ u_int16_t       rlsservice;             /* rel time (us) for service */
105	u_int16_t       reserved73;
106	u_int16_t       reserved74;
107/*075*/ u_int16_t       queue;
108#define ATA_QUEUE_LEN(x)                ((x) & 0x001f)
109
110	u_int16_t       satacapabilities;
111#define ATA_SATA_GEN1                   0x0002
112#define ATA_SATA_GEN2                   0x0004
113#define ATA_SUPPORT_NCQ                 0x0100
114#define ATA_SUPPORT_IFPWRMNGTRCV        0x0200
115
116	u_int16_t       reserved77;
117	u_int16_t       satasupport;
118#define ATA_SUPPORT_NONZERO             0x0002
119#define ATA_SUPPORT_AUTOACTIVATE        0x0004
120#define ATA_SUPPORT_IFPWRMNGT           0x0008
121#define ATA_SUPPORT_INORDERDATA         0x0010
122	u_int16_t       sataenabled;
123
124/*080*/ u_int16_t       version_major;
125/*081*/ u_int16_t       version_minor;
126
127	struct {
128/*082/085*/ u_int16_t   command1;
129#define ATA_SUPPORT_SMART               0x0001
130#define ATA_SUPPORT_SECURITY            0x0002
131#define ATA_SUPPORT_REMOVABLE           0x0004
132#define ATA_SUPPORT_POWERMGT            0x0008
133#define ATA_SUPPORT_PACKET              0x0010
134#define ATA_SUPPORT_WRITECACHE          0x0020
135#define ATA_SUPPORT_LOOKAHEAD           0x0040
136#define ATA_SUPPORT_RELEASEIRQ          0x0080
137#define ATA_SUPPORT_SERVICEIRQ          0x0100
138#define ATA_SUPPORT_RESET               0x0200
139#define ATA_SUPPORT_PROTECTED           0x0400
140#define ATA_SUPPORT_WRITEBUFFER         0x1000
141#define ATA_SUPPORT_READBUFFER          0x2000
142#define ATA_SUPPORT_NOP                 0x4000
143
144/*083/086*/ u_int16_t   command2;
145#define ATA_SUPPORT_MICROCODE           0x0001
146#define ATA_SUPPORT_QUEUED              0x0002
147#define ATA_SUPPORT_CFA                 0x0004
148#define ATA_SUPPORT_APM                 0x0008
149#define ATA_SUPPORT_NOTIFY              0x0010
150#define ATA_SUPPORT_STANDBY             0x0020
151#define ATA_SUPPORT_SPINUP              0x0040
152#define ATA_SUPPORT_MAXSECURITY         0x0100
153#define ATA_SUPPORT_AUTOACOUSTIC        0x0200
154#define ATA_SUPPORT_ADDRESS48           0x0400
155#define ATA_SUPPORT_OVERLAY             0x0800
156#define ATA_SUPPORT_FLUSHCACHE          0x1000
157#define ATA_SUPPORT_FLUSHCACHE48        0x2000
158
159/*084/087*/ u_int16_t   extension;
160	} __packed support, enabled;
161
162/*088*/ u_int16_t       udmamodes;              /* UltraDMA modes */
163/*089*/ u_int16_t       erase_time;
164/*090*/ u_int16_t       enhanced_erase_time;
165/*091*/ u_int16_t       apm_value;
166/*092*/ u_int16_t       master_passwd_revision;
167/*093*/ u_int16_t       hwres;
168#define ATA_CABLE_ID                    0x2000
169
170/*094*/ u_int16_t       acoustic;
171#define ATA_ACOUSTIC_CURRENT(x)         ((x) & 0x00ff)
172#define ATA_ACOUSTIC_VENDOR(x)          (((x) & 0xff00) >> 8)
173
174/*095*/ u_int16_t       stream_min_req_size;
175/*096*/ u_int16_t       stream_transfer_time;
176/*097*/ u_int16_t       stream_access_latency;
177/*098*/ u_int32_t       stream_granularity;
178/*100*/ u_int16_t       lba_size48_1;
179	u_int16_t       lba_size48_2;
180	u_int16_t       lba_size48_3;
181	u_int16_t       lba_size48_4;
182	u_int16_t       reserved104[23];
183/*127*/ u_int16_t       removable_status;
184/*128*/ u_int16_t       security_status;
185	u_int16_t       reserved129[31];
186/*160*/ u_int16_t       cfa_powermode1;
187	u_int16_t       reserved161[15];
188/*176*/ u_int16_t       media_serial[30];
189	u_int16_t       reserved206[49];
190/*255*/ u_int16_t       integrity;
191} __packed;

223/* ATA commands */
224#define ATA_NOP                         0x00    /* NOP */
225#define         ATA_NF_FLUSHQUEUE       0x00    /* flush queued cmd's */
226#define         ATA_NF_AUTOPOLL         0x01    /* start autopoll function */
227#define ATA_DEVICE_RESET                0x08    /* reset device */
228#define ATA_READ                        0x20    /* read */
229#define ATA_READ48                      0x24    /* read 48bit LBA */
230#define ATA_READ_DMA48                  0x25    /* read DMA 48bit LBA */
231#define ATA_READ_DMA_QUEUED48           0x26    /* read DMA QUEUED 48bit LBA */
232#define ATA_READ_NATIVE_MAX_ADDDRESS48  0x27    /* read native max addr 48bit */
233#define ATA_READ_MUL48                  0x29    /* read multi 48bit LBA */
234#define ATA_WRITE                       0x30    /* write */
235#define ATA_WRITE48                     0x34    /* write 48bit LBA */
236#define ATA_WRITE_DMA48                 0x35    /* write DMA 48bit LBA */
237#define ATA_WRITE_DMA_QUEUED48          0x36    /* write DMA QUEUED 48bit LBA*/
238#define ATA_SET_MAX_ADDRESS48           0x37    /* set max address 48bit */
239#define ATA_WRITE_MUL48                 0x39    /* write multi 48bit LBA */
240#define ATA_READ_FPDMA_QUEUED           0x60    /* read DMA NCQ */
241#define ATA_WRITE_FPDMA_QUEUED          0x61    /* write DMA NCQ */
242#define ATA_SEEK                        0x70    /* seek */
243#define ATA_PACKET_CMD                  0xa0    /* packet command */
244#define ATA_ATAPI_IDENTIFY              0xa1    /* get ATAPI params*/
245#define ATA_SERVICE                     0xa2    /* service command */
246#define ATA_CFA_ERASE                   0xc0    /* CFA erase */
247#define ATA_READ_MUL                    0xc4    /* read multi */
248#define ATA_WRITE_MUL                   0xc5    /* write multi */
249#define ATA_SET_MULTI                   0xc6    /* set multi size */
250#define ATA_READ_DMA_QUEUED             0xc7    /* read DMA QUEUED */
251#define ATA_READ_DMA                    0xc8    /* read DMA */
252#define ATA_WRITE_DMA                   0xca    /* write DMA */
253#define ATA_WRITE_DMA_QUEUED            0xcc    /* write DMA QUEUED */
254#define ATA_STANDBY_IMMEDIATE           0xe0    /* standby immediate */
255#define ATA_IDLE_IMMEDIATE              0xe1    /* idle immediate */
256#define ATA_STANDBY_CMD                 0xe2    /* standby */
257#define ATA_IDLE_CMD                    0xe3    /* idle */
258#define ATA_READ_BUFFER                 0xe4    /* read buffer */
259#define ATA_SLEEP                       0xe6    /* sleep */
260#define ATA_FLUSHCACHE                  0xe7    /* flush cache to disk */
261#define ATA_FLUSHCACHE48                0xea    /* flush cache to disk */
262#define ATA_ATA_IDENTIFY                0xec    /* get ATA params */
263#define ATA_SETFEATURES                 0xef    /* features command */
264#define         ATA_SF_SETXFER          0x03    /* set transfer mode */
265#define         ATA_SF_ENAB_WCACHE      0x02    /* enable write cache */
266#define         ATA_SF_DIS_WCACHE       0x82    /* disable write cache */
267#define         ATA_SF_ENAB_RCACHE      0xaa    /* enable readahead cache */
268#define         ATA_SF_DIS_RCACHE       0x55    /* disable readahead cache */
269#define         ATA_SF_ENAB_RELIRQ      0x5d    /* enable release interrupt */
270#define         ATA_SF_DIS_RELIRQ       0xdd    /* disable release interrupt */
271#define         ATA_SF_ENAB_SRVIRQ      0x5e    /* enable service interrupt */
272#define         ATA_SF_DIS_SRVIRQ       0xde    /* disable service interrupt */
273#define ATA_SECURITY_FREEE_LOCK         0xf5    /* freeze security config */
274#define ATA_READ_NATIVE_MAX_ADDDRESS    0xf8    /* read native max address */
275#define ATA_SET_MAX_ADDRESS             0xf9    /* set max address */

278/* ATAPI commands */
279#define ATAPI_TEST_UNIT_READY           0x00    /* check if device is ready */
280#define ATAPI_REZERO                    0x01    /* rewind */
281#define ATAPI_REQUEST_SENSE             0x03    /* get sense data */
282#define ATAPI_FORMAT                    0x04    /* format unit */
283#define ATAPI_READ                      0x08    /* read data */
284#define ATAPI_WRITE                     0x0a    /* write data */
285#define ATAPI_WEOF                      0x10    /* write filemark */
286#define         ATAPI_WF_WRITE          0x01
287#define ATAPI_SPACE                     0x11    /* space command */
288#define         ATAPI_SP_FM             0x01
289#define         ATAPI_SP_EOD            0x03
290#define ATAPI_INQUIRY			0x12	/* get inquiry data */
291#define ATAPI_MODE_SELECT               0x15    /* mode select */
292#define ATAPI_ERASE                     0x19    /* erase */
293#define ATAPI_MODE_SENSE                0x1a    /* mode sense */
294#define ATAPI_START_STOP                0x1b    /* start/stop unit */
295#define         ATAPI_SS_LOAD           0x01
296#define         ATAPI_SS_RETENSION      0x02
297#define         ATAPI_SS_EJECT          0x04
298#define ATAPI_PREVENT_ALLOW             0x1e    /* media removal */
299#define ATAPI_READ_FORMAT_CAPACITIES    0x23    /* get format capacities */
300#define ATAPI_READ_CAPACITY             0x25    /* get volume capacity */
301#define ATAPI_READ_BIG                  0x28    /* read data */
302#define ATAPI_WRITE_BIG                 0x2a    /* write data */
303#define ATAPI_LOCATE                    0x2b    /* locate to position */
304#define ATAPI_READ_POSITION             0x34    /* read position */
305#define ATAPI_SYNCHRONIZE_CACHE         0x35    /* flush buf, close channel */
306#define ATAPI_WRITE_BUFFER              0x3b    /* write device buffer */
307#define ATAPI_READ_BUFFER               0x3c    /* read device buffer */
308#define ATAPI_READ_SUBCHANNEL           0x42    /* get subchannel info */
309#define ATAPI_READ_TOC                  0x43    /* get table of contents */
310#define ATAPI_PLAY_10                   0x45    /* play by lba */
311#define ATAPI_PLAY_MSF                  0x47    /* play by MSF address */
312#define ATAPI_PLAY_TRACK                0x48    /* play by track number */
313#define ATAPI_PAUSE                     0x4b    /* pause audio operation */
314#define ATAPI_READ_DISK_INFO            0x51    /* get disk info structure */
315#define ATAPI_READ_TRACK_INFO           0x52    /* get track info structure */
316#define ATAPI_RESERVE_TRACK             0x53    /* reserve track */
317#define ATAPI_SEND_OPC_INFO             0x54    /* send OPC structurek */
318#define ATAPI_MODE_SELECT_BIG           0x55    /* set device parameters */
319#define ATAPI_REPAIR_TRACK              0x58    /* repair track */
320#define ATAPI_READ_MASTER_CUE           0x59    /* read master CUE info */
321#define ATAPI_MODE_SENSE_BIG            0x5a    /* get device parameters */
322#define ATAPI_CLOSE_TRACK               0x5b    /* close track/session */
323#define ATAPI_READ_BUFFER_CAPACITY      0x5c    /* get buffer capicity */
324#define ATAPI_SEND_CUE_SHEET            0x5d    /* send CUE sheet */
325#define ATAPI_SERVICE_ACTION_IN         0x96	/* get service data */
326#define ATAPI_BLANK                     0xa1    /* blank the media */
327#define ATAPI_SEND_KEY                  0xa3    /* send DVD key structure */
328#define ATAPI_REPORT_KEY                0xa4    /* get DVD key structure */
329#define ATAPI_PLAY_12                   0xa5    /* play by lba */
330#define ATAPI_LOAD_UNLOAD               0xa6    /* changer control command */
331#define ATAPI_READ_STRUCTURE            0xad    /* get DVD structure */
332#define ATAPI_PLAY_CD                   0xb4    /* universal play command */
333#define ATAPI_SET_SPEED                 0xbb    /* set drive speed */
334#define ATAPI_MECH_STATUS               0xbd    /* get changer status */
335#define ATAPI_READ_CD                   0xbe    /* read data */
336#define ATAPI_POLL_DSC                  0xff    /* poll DSC status bit */
